1

The best Side of best solar installation company california

News Discuss 
Momentum’s model comes with limits. It’s a tad obscure about which panels it installs and will not provide professional checking. Its application reviews may also be pretty lower, which can cause some problems for property solar shoppers checking their unique systems. We closely evaluate solar installation companies which has a https://www.americanarraysolar.com/how-much-do-solar-panels-in-manteca-cost/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story